How the Square Yards Calculator works?

The Square Yards Calculator is a versatile tool designed to help you convert various area measurements into square yards. It works by taking your input dimensions (length and width) in your chosen unit of measurement (feet, inches, or meters) and applying the appropriate conversion factors to calculate the area in square yards.

Conversion Formulas

• From Square Feet: 1 square yard = 9 square feet
• From Square Inches: 1 square yard = 1,296 square inches
• From Square Meters: 1 square yard ≈ 0.836127 square meters

The calculator automatically performs these conversions and provides you with the area in square yards, along with equivalent values in square feet and square meters for comprehensive reference. This makes it particularly useful for construction, flooring, landscaping, and other projects where accurate area measurements are crucial.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Why do I need to calculate square yards?

Square yards are commonly used in construction and home improvement, particularly for carpeting, flooring, and landscaping. Many suppliers price materials by the square yard, making it essential for accurate cost estimation and material ordering.

2. How accurate are the conversion results?

The calculator provides results accurate to two decimal places. The conversions use standard mathematical ratios: 1 square yard equals exactly 9 square feet or 1,296 square inches, and approximately 0.836127 square meters.

3. Should I add extra material for waste?

Yes, it's recommended to add 5-10% extra material for waste, cuts, and mistakes. For complex room layouts or patterns, you might want to increase this to 15-20%. This ensures you have enough material to complete your project without running short.

4. Can I use this calculator for irregular shapes?

This calculator is designed for rectangular areas. For irregular shapes, break down the area into smaller rectangles, calculate each separately, and add the results together. For very complex shapes, consider consulting a professional for precise measurements.
